great orbital for the price. I've tried larger and smaller orbital polishers and i really like this size. The large one sometimes grabs on something and pulls out of your hands. Smaller ones just take forever, this is sorta in the middle. But the things i like. Orbitals sometimes are super vibrating so your hands can end up numb from all the vibration. This one is somewhat smoother, i found the handles great in keeping the device steady. My hands did not get numb, vibrations were much less then others. The built on black pad seems pretty soft with just enough flex. I polished my nitrocellulose lacquered guitars to take out some light to med scratches and it worked great, these were deep but not through to the paint. Was able to get about 3/4 of the scratch so that it's barely visible line instead of the visible scratch that it was before. So for hobbyist as well, this is a good size.. Also used on my black lexus with meguires compound and ultimate polishes and these pads just work great with this polisher. You can buy some heavy duty velcro pads i think 2 of the 2x4" velcro will hold the meguires 6" da pads. Don't mistakenly buy the da 4" pads, they are too small. But i used the red compound pad for taking light scratches and tree sap and that kind of stuff off, then ultimate polish with the yellow polishing pad and came out super glossy. Took off the white haze on the headlights too. Really easy to handle with the extra handle on top. I think this is great for the price. Easy for novice detailer to get good results without using a prof high rpm device that can burn the paint.

Used this to repair headlights from UV oxidation. Used turtlewax product with it. Took my time and turned out great!!! It stopped me from using too much pressure and damaging the lights. Excellent tool. *follow-up * Used this again on my other daughter's highlander- again with the turtlewax headlight Restore.... And mcguire's u v protection spray for headlights after the job was done... this thing has paid for itself - body shops here wanted $75 to do this... showed the before and after photos. The tool works. It's "me proof" since I tend to complicated the simple and mess up the basics. There are youtube videos out there showing how to use the random orbit polisher to remove UV oxidation. Watch as few, get an understanding of the process.. I also used a micro fiber cloth to wipe it clean before applying the McGuiers UV protection spray when I was done removing the oxidation. Side note....corners are difficult. The bottom right corner about an inch squared I couldn't Get to it this tool because of the angle of the light. I just did thst by hand withba rag and some of the turtlewax product. Total time for one headlight... approx 45 min including waiting between coats for the Mcguires sealer.
